Output 77f7598e1357d542f3cdf11e5de6e429b2efd18970e8b14e65480c302fe45605:6

value
40452900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e8257aef2dbf0a0557d457e295f65d2c2c3fcba OP_EQUALVERIFY OP_CHECKSIG
address
16hX3FWFk4iqkFMJYRB4CT1EGFc9r9isFW
transaction
77f7598e1357d542f3cdf11e5de6e429b2efd18970e8b14e65480c302fe45605
spent
true